The Michigan Corporation Form Blank with Name is a critical document used for initiating construction projects on real property in Michigan. It serves as a formal notice to lien claimants and potential buyers that work is about to commence, and outlines the necessary steps to preserve construction liens. Key features include sections for filling in the name of the corporation, owner's information, property details, and necessary signatures. Users must complete and return the form to the requester within ten days, and if they do not reside at the site, they must post a copy at the location. This form is particularly useful for att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ants, as it ensures compliance with Michigan law regarding construction lien rights. How to Incorporate in Michigan. To start a corporation in Michigan, you'll need to do three things: appoint a registered agent, choose a name for your business, and file Articles of Incorporation with the Department of Licensing and Regulatory Affairs (LARA). You can file this document online, by mail or in person.

Filing your Articles of Organization by Mail Download the Michigan LLC Articles of Organization (Form CD-700) Prepare a check or money order for $50. ... Send your payment and the completed Articles of Organization to: Michigan Corporations Division, PO Box 30054, Lansing, MI 48909-7554.

If you wish to operate under a new name, your Michigan corporation has to follow the legal process. Filing an amendment will inform the state of your plan to change the company name. Aside from this, you also need to make sure that all government records reflect the new name of your corporation.
